Dublin Council secures right to purchase Dartmouth Square

Dublin City Council has secured a Compulsory Purchase Order on the square in south Dublin under threat of being turned into a car park.

The council sought the right to purchase Dartmouth Square after its owner closed it to the public earlier this year.
